Check auction sites 2018 with 1300hrs sold for 34k. Prices are high right now but...45 trade in idk 40 maybe but dealer will get you on other end. Used equipment for a dealer is a risk it .costs us 1200 a day to fix tradins. We work on all kinds of great auction finds customers bring us. If you want to play you have to pay and if you cant fix it yourself plan on paying another 10k after your action deal. It's the same for the dealer they could easily spend 10k on your trade in when the mechanics could be working on a customer machine where the money is coming in not out. Dont think for a minute the dealer will make 20k on your trade in.
